In 2024, global cookie exports reached an estimated US$12.5 billion.
This represents a 46.7% increase compared to 2020, when total sweet biscuit exports stood at $8.5 billion.
On a year-over-year basis, global cookie exports rose by 4.3%, up from $12 billion in 2023.
Also known as sweet biscuits in many parts of the world, cookies remain one of the most popular snack foods globally.
According to Tendata, favorites in the United States include chocolate chip, peanut butter, oatmeal raisin, white chocolate, sugar, and shortbread cookies.
Leading Exporters
The world's top five cookie exporters in 2024 were Mexico, the Netherlands, Germany, Belgium, and Italy.
Together, these five suppliers accounted for nearly 40% (39.8%) of global cookie export value.
From a regional perspective, Europe dominated the international cookie trade, exporting goods worth $7 billion—about 56.4% of total global sales.
Asia ranked second, contributing 19.2%, followed closely by North America with 17.3%.
Smaller shares came from Latin America (4.2%)—excluding Mexico but including the Caribbean—Africa (2.1%), and Oceania (0.8%), led by Australia, New Zealand, and Fiji.
For trade classification purposes, the Harmonized Tariff System (HTS) code for sweet biscuits (cookies) is 190531.

Top 15 Cookie Exporting Countries (2024)
1.Mexico – US$1.3 billion (10.6% of total exports)
2.Netherlands – $1.1 billion (8.8%)
3.Germany – $1.1 billion (8.7%)
4.Belgium – $815.2 million (6.5%)
5.Italy – $640.8 million (5.1%)
6.Canada – $559 million (4.5%)
7.Türkiye – $493.1 million (4%)
8.United Kingdom – $486.5 million (3.9%)
9.France – $477.9 million (3.8%)
10.Poland – $456.8 million (3.7%)
11.Indonesia – $443.8 million (3.6%)
12.Spain – $409.2 million (3.3%)
13.India – $349 million (2.8%)
14.Czech Republic – $295.5 million (2.4%)
15.United States – $272.4 million (2.2%)
Together, these 15 countries accounted for roughly 73.8% of global cookie exports in 2024.
Export Growth Trends
Among the major exporters, the fastest-growing markets since 2023 were:
·Italy (+21.8%)
·United Kingdom (+13.2%)
·France (+9.4%)
·Türkiye (+8.3%)
Conversely, Spain (-8.6%) and the Czech Republic (-1.6%) recorded year-over-year declines in export value.
Major Cookie Exporting Companies (2024)
According to Tendata Global Trade Data, the following are examples of leading cookie-exporting companies worldwide:
1.MONDELEZ PERU S.A. – 7.15% ($114.85 million)
2.COMERCIALIZADORA PEPSICO MEXICO – 6.47% ($103.97 million)
3.PT MAYORA INDAH TBK – 6.05% ($97.15 million)
4.Roshen Confectionery Corporation (Ukraine) – 5.74% ($92.23 million)
5.ООО ТК РЕСУРС ЮГ – 4.62% ($74.32 million)
6.Compañía de Galletas Pozuelo DCR S.A. – 3.52% ($56.62 million)
7.Compañía de Galletas Noel S.A.S. – 3.37% ($54.21 million)
8.Compañía de Galletas Pozuelo DCR Sociedad Anónima – 3.11% ($50.03 million)
9.Industria Nacional Alimenticia S.A. – 2.99% ($48.03 million)
10.BIMBO – 2.79% ($44.82 million)
